Transaction 330ff5659071de88df53b507753a512b684f54863316c9032c94c0e1c1d64d9a
1 Input
1 Output
-
330ff5659071de88df53b507753a512b684f54863316c9032c94c0e1c1d64d9a:0
- value
- 733469
- script pubkey
- OP_0 OP_PUSHBYTES_20 d50a89186501aa1b07ce9b09861121ecbee5603b
- address
- bc1q659gjxr9qx4pkp7wnvycvyfpajlw2cpmvu5tlc